Dhaka Mohammedan SC made a flying start to the Manyavar Bangladesh Premier Football League crushing Chittagong Abahani by 5-0 goals in their first match at the Bangabandhu National Stadium on Thursday.
In the second match of the day, Brothers Union Club drew goalless with Team BJMC at the same venue.
The Guinean forward Ismael Bangoura put Mohammedan DC ahead in the 59th minute by a cool header (1-0).
Towhidul Alam Sobuj doubled the margin for the traditional black and white team in the 66th minute by a placing shot, capitalising on a long pass of Mobarak Hossain (2-0).
Sabuj scored his second and the 3rd goal for Mohammedan SC in the 70th minute by a re-bounder when an attempt of his mate Mohammad Ibrahim came his way from opponent goalie Ershad (3-0).
Ismael Bangoura netted his 2nd and the 4th goal for Mohammedan in the 85th minute by a ground shot, also from a re-bounder, when an attempt of Jonny came his way hitting custodian Ershad again (4-0).
In the stoppage time, Arup Baidya sealed the fate of the match scoring the 5th goal for Mohammedan by a side-footed placing shot off a square pass of Bangoura (5-0).
Earlier, Chittagong Abahani forward Sumon Ali carrying an Abdul Hannan Raju through pass went past the Mohammedan defense but his attempt hit the side post from a close.
In the 50th minute, Mohammedan forward Touhidul Alam Sabuj placed the ball over Abahani goalie Ershad but defender Prodip Barua cleared the ball from the goal-line.
